Heritage Room Scroll

Description: Mural on south wall of Heritage Room, depicting 17 scenes throughout the history of northeast Tarrant County, from the coming of the settlers from Missouri to DFW Airport. The mural, which measures 20' x 8' was painted by five local artists: Evelyn Schmidt, Joy Clifton, Freddie Fisher, Rebecca Maus, and J. Paul Davidson in 1975 as part of the college's celebration of the US Bicentennial.

[Photograph of the mural, The Rebirth of Our Nationality]

Description: Photograph of Leo Tanguma's "The Rebirth of Our Nationality", a mural spanning a building on Canal Street in Houston, Texas. The brightly colored mural depicts multiple figures reaching toward each other. At the top of the mural: "To become aware of our history is to become aware of our singularity." The work was completed in 1973 during the Chicano mural movement.
